Wipro Expands in Airoli With Rs 2.5 Cr Monthly Lease

IT services major Wipro Limited has expanded its commercial footprint by leasing 3.87 lakh square feet of office space in Mindspace Business Parks, Airoli, near Mumbai. According to property registration records accessed by Propstack, the lease is valued at a monthly rent of approximately Rs 24.8 million.
This new lease adds to Wipro’s existing occupancy of 3.45 lakh square feet within the same business park. The agreement with Mindspace Business Parks Private Limited began on 31 July 2024 and spans a 10-year term.
Wipro will occupy eight consecutive floors—from the 4th to the 11th—with a carpet area of 270,949 square feet and a chargeable area of 387,072 square feet. The lease has been signed at a rate of Rs 64 per square foot, with provisions for an annual rental escalation of 5 per cent.
A security deposit of Rs 148.6 million was paid as part of the agreement. The lease was executed through two transactions and officially registered on 21 May 2025. Documents also show a stamp duty of nearly Rs 1.3 million and a registration fee of Rs 60,000 were paid.
Mindspace Business Parks in Airoli, Navi Mumbai, is a key hub for domestic and global enterprises across various sectors, including information technology, consulting, healthcare technology, and financial services.
Besides Wipro, major tenants include L&T Infotech (LTI), LTI–Mindtree, Accenture, Cognizant, IBM India, CRISIL (a subsidiary of S&P Global), Axis Bank, and Capgemini India, among others.
